Embodiment 1

[0026] Use degreased marine fish meal as raw material, mix evenly with water according to 1:10 ratio of material to water, at 121°C, 1.05kg / cm 2 Cook under pressure for 25 minutes, take out and cool down to 60°C. Adjust the pH value of the cooking liquid to 9, use alkaline protease Alcalase 2.4L (Novozymes, Denmark) as the enzymatic enzyme, control the concentration ratio of enzyme and substrate to 1%, carry out enzymatic hydrolysis at 60°C, and keep it in the enzyme During the hydrolysis process, the pH is stable. After the enzymolysis is completed, the temperature is raised to 92° C., inactivated for 10 minutes, and the filtrate is vacuum concentrated at a concentration temperature of 60° C. and a concentration pressure of 0.1 MPa, and finally dried to obtain the product.

[0027] After testing, the oligopeptide content in the low-value marine fish peptide powder prepared in this example is 30.80%, which is a high-quality low-value marine fish peptide powder.

Embodiment 2

[0029] Use degreased marine fish meal as raw material, mix evenly with water according to the material-water ratio of 1:5, at 115°C, 0.75kg / cm 2 Cook under pressure for 20 minutes, take out and cool down to 60°C. Adjust the pH value of the cooking liquid to 7.0, use flavor protease (Novozymes, Denmark) as the enzyme for enzymolysis, control the concentration ratio of enzyme and substrate to 0.5%, carry out enzymolysis at 45°C, and keep the pH during the enzymolysis process Stable, after enzymatic hydrolysis, the temperature is raised to 90°C, inactivated for 10 minutes, and the filtrate is vacuum-concentrated at a concentration temperature of 65°C and a concentration pressure of 0.12 MPa, and finally dried to obtain the product.

[0030] After testing, the oligopeptide content in the low-value marine fish peptide powder prepared in this example is 28.00%, which is a high-quality low-value marine fish peptide powder.

Embodiment 3

[0032] Use degreased marine fish meal as raw material, mix evenly with water according to 1: 12.5 ratio of material to water, at 130°C, 1.75kg / cm 2 Cook under pressure for 30 minutes, take out and cool down to 60°C. Adjust the pH value of the cooking liquid to 9.5, use alkaline protease (Wuxi Genencor Bioengineering Co., Ltd.) The pH is stable during the process. After the enzymolysis is completed, the temperature is raised to 95°C, inactivated for 10 minutes, and the filtrate is vacuum-concentrated at a concentration temperature of 65°C and a concentration pressure of 0.12 MPa, and finally dried to obtain the product.

[0033] After testing, the oligopeptide content in the low-value marine fish peptide powder prepared in this example is 25.27%, which is a high-quality low-value marine fish peptide powder.

Abstract

The invention provides a method for preparing fish meal protein peptide. The method comprises the following steps: (1) taking defatted marine fish meal as a raw material, and adding water for dissolving according to the weight-bulk ratio of material to liquid being (1: 5)-(12.5); (2) under the temperature of 115-130 DEG C and pressure of 0.75-1.75 kg/cm<2>, cooking for 20-30 minutes; cooling to obtain cooking liquid; (3) adjusting the pH value of the cooking liquid to 7.0-9.5; adding protease, controlling the mass concentration ratio of protease to substrate to be 0.5-2.5 percent, and carrying out enzymolysis under the temperature of 45-70 DEG C to obtain enzymatic hydrolysate; and (4) heating the enzymatic hydrolysate to the temperature of 90-95 DEG C, inactivating and drying. The fish meal protein peptide is high in small-molecule oligopeptide content and digestibility. The fish meal protein peptide as a feed additive is matched with feed to be eaten by animals, so that the bioavailability of fish meal protein can be improved, the animal immunity also can be improved, and the disease resistance is enhanced.

technical field [0001] The invention belongs to the technical field of marine fish deep processing, and in particular relates to a preparation method of low-value marine fish peptide powder. Background technique [0002] Fishmeal is a high-protein powder obtained from one or more types of marine fish, especially small non-edible fish as raw materials, after a series of processes such as cooking, pressing, dehydration and crushing. Fishmeal is the most commonly used protein source in aquafeeds due to its high quality. Fishmeal has become the most commonly used and most important animal in aquatic feed due to its rich content of essential amino acids, balanced amino acid composition, high protein content, good palatability, high digestibility, high unsaturated fatty acids and low anti-nutritional factors. sex protein source.
